Kew Bridge Station, while lacking the traditional ticket office, provides ample means for travelers to purchase and collect their tickets from the available machines at the station. However, travelers requiring accessible ticket machines will alas not find them here. Fortunately, for those who have purchased tickets online, these can conveniently be collected from the station's ticket machines located on site.
Travelers with queries or in need of assistance can rely on help points scattered around the station. Although there are no staff members on-site to offer personal help, passengers can contact the customer service line at 0345 6000 650 for support. CCTV cameras ensure that the station remains safe and secure.
When it comes to accessibility, Kew Bridge Station falls short with no step-free access, making it challenging for those with mobility impairments. However, assistance is provided by the onboard guard when boarding or alighting trains. Unfortunately, there are no accessible facilities such as toilets or staff help for those who might need it.

When planning a journey from Honley, it's important to be aware of the station's facilities. While the station does not have a staffed ticket office, it does provide ticket machines for your convenience, including options for collecting tickets purchased online. Moreover, the machines are equipped with accessible features, making it easier for everyone to use.
The absence of specific amenities at Honley, such as shops, restrooms, or seating areas, means it's wise to arrive prepared. However, if you find yourself in need of assistance, there are help points available on the platform, ensuring you can reach staff via their helpline if needed. Keep in mind, there is no luggage storage or CCTV on site, so plan accordingly.
Accessibility can be a challenge as Honley Station is categorized as a Category C station with no step-free access. Be prepared to navigate 27 steps to reach the platform. For those who might require assistance, conductors are available on trains to offer help using boarding ramps. Travellers are encouraged to book assistance up to 2 hours before their planned departure through the Passenger Assist service.
Parking, cycling facilities, and additional accessible services such as taxis or spaces for impaired mobility are not available here, so plan your journey accordingly.
Honley's transportation connections make planning your onward journey straightforward. A rail replacement service is available outside the station entrance, and taxis can be easily arranged through services like CAB4YOU. Additionally, a convenient bus stop nearby allows you to access local bus services using the Busline at 0871 200 2233.
